Supernatural Suddenlies

   

Dearest darling
You are very special
God's gift to the world
Filled with His Spirit
Wise with His Word

My spiritual sweetheart
You are happily harnessed
Captivated by God's calling
To sin not falling
To His Spirit joyously yielding
The sword of His Word wielding

Sweet lovely lady
Your sorrows to God are known
Though through them you've grown
Learning in Christ you have a home
Certainly you're never alone.
So when your mind wants to roam
And heart wants to moan
Hold on to God's unchanging hand
He'll lead you into your own
Your promised possession
Your personal inheritance
His relational blessing
And a glorious countenance.
So settle for nothing less
Than God's ultimate best
Believe as you have
For the desires of your heart
Trust in your heavenly Father
From Him don't depart.
Remain on God's easel
You're a wonderful work of art
Let patience have its perfect work
And the Shepherd of your soul satisfy
For you will no longer cry
Nor wonder and ask why
For He who sits in the heavenly skies
Shall show Himself strong and soon reply
Answering each prayer
Fulfilling each promise
Making wrongs right
Clarifying confusing traumas
Giving you abundantly more
Settling lifes dramas.
For this is your year
The year of Gods favor
A time of His Presence and peace
An experience to savor
To embrace
To cherish
To hold dear to your heart
The floodgates of heaven are open
Let the celebration now start!

by Paul Davis - poet and prophet
